Bangor City Council censured Councilor Joe Leonard for reacting emotionally with a pen throw and gesture during a Zoom meeting where neo-Nazi rhetoric was promoted, sparking debate on conduct and free speech.

The Bangor City Council censured Councilor Joe Leonard 5-2 for a third time in 2025 after he reacted emotionally during a Zoom meeting, throwing a pen and making an obscene gesture toward a participant promoting neo-Nazi ideologies.

The council condemned the hate speech but split on whether Leonard’s response was disproportionate.

A resolution unanimously passed to formally denounce hate speech in public meetings, emphasizing decorum while affirming free speech protections.

The incident sparked debate over appropriate conduct in government and the balance between emotional reactions and civic responsibility.
